Xiaomi Mi Note 10

Xiaomi MI Note 10 is a re-branded version of Mi CC9 Pro

Finally, the Xiaomi has announced a much-awaited Mi Note 10 smartphone at an event held in Spain. As expected, it is the global version of Mi CC9 Pro announced yesterday in China. There is not even a single change except difference prices for global markets and Google Play services support. The key USP of this device is absolutely a Penta-lens rear camera with 108MP primary sensor. In the meantime, the company has also showcased Mi Note 10 Pro. The only difference between Mi Note 10 and Mi Note 10 Pro is 7P vs 8P primary lens and some extra RAM and storage.

Xiaomi Mi Note 10 Specifications

The Xiaomi Mi Note 10 smartphone comes with a 6.47-inch 1080 x 2340 pixels Full HD+ AMOLED display at 600nit brightness. It is powered by the Qualcomm Snapdragon 730G SoC combined with Adreno 618 GPU. It runs on Android 9 Pie based on MIUI 11 out of the box. All the necessary connectivity options are available including NFC and Infrared sensor. The device ultimately utilizes the AMOLED panel by bringing an in-display fingerprint sensor.

The most highlighted point of this smartphone is five rear cameras. It boasts 108MP main 1/1.33-inch Samsung ISOCELL Bright HMX sensor + 12MP, Samsung SAK2L3 (telephoto) + another 8MP (telephoto) and 20MP ultra-wide sensor combined with 2MP dedicated video macro lens. In addition, the primary camera is well capable of producing 5x optical zoom with IOS as well as 50x digital zoom, the company further pointed out. It has another 32MP, f/2.2 front-facing camera for selfies.

The handset packs 5260 mAh non-removable battery, that supports 30W fast charging out of the box. The Mi Note 10 Pro comes with 6GB RAM / 128GB storage variant for the European market without any micro SD slot option. The Mi Note 10 Pro has an additional 8GB RAM and 256GB built-in storage. Nevertheless, it doesn’t bring any IP rating neither Wireless charging support. That could be a drawback for some users, but the company overall delivers a good package.

Specifications Summary

  • Display: 6.47-inch 1080 x 2340 pixels Full HD+ AMOLED
  • Processor: Snapdragon 730G, GPU: Adreno 618
  • Rear Camera: Penta-lens 108 MP + 5MP + 12 MP + 20 MP + 2 MP
  • Front Camera: 32MP
  • RAM & Storage: 6/8GB RAM, 128/256GB internal storage; non-expendable
  • Operating System: Android 9 Pie; MIUI 11
  • Battery: 5260 mAh non-removal, 30W fast charging support
  • Dimensions: 157.8×74.2×9.67mm, Weight: 208 grams
  • Pricing Details: 6GB RAM / 128GB=€549 (approx. Rs. 43,200) or 8GB RAM / 256GB storage (Mi Note 10 Pro)=€649 (approx. Rs. 51,000)

Xiaomi Mi Note 10 Pricing and Availability

The Xiaomi Mi Note 10 comes in Aurora Green, Glacier White, and Midnight Black color options. Considering the price, it costs €549 for the base variant, which goes up to €649 for a higher 8GB RAM and 256GB built-in storage option for Mi Note 10 Pro. The device will start selling from November 11 in Germany, November 15 for Spain & Italy and France will get it by November 18.

Other European markets may also get this device by the end of this month, even though the company didn’t reveal the exact date. Besides, there is no information available regarding its Indian launch. That is a crucial market for mid-range smartphones, but Xiaomi hasn’t been lucky enough with its premium line-up in India. In the coming days, we will hear more about its global approach.
